Data Logger

• They are developed recently and accepted universally


in medium to big plants
• It has a microprocessor or computer based control
system
• The analog or digital inputs are received serially after
scanning
• Then processed and sent to storage units

Data Logger Systems

• It is a data acquisition system

• That measures the analog inputs , translates the

results into digital domain , and stores the data for

future processing for analysis.

• Data logger provides an automated method of making

the measurements and recording the data effectively&

accurately by eliminating measurement errors

AEI504.43 5
Data Logger Systems

• It can perform the above functions at precise intervals

and with degree of accuracy beyond any persons

physical capability.

• Because data is stored in digital format , the data

analysis is easily performed by off- line computer .

Advantages of Data Logger Systems

• Since many data loggers are highly portable , data


taken can be automated even in very remote
locations

AEI504.43 11
Characteristics

1. Modularity : The system can be expanded whenever

required ,simple and efficiently.

2. Reliability and ruggedness: Designed to operate

continuously without interrupts even in the worst

industrial environments .For this purpose whole

system is made quite rugged.

AEI504.43 12
Characteristics

1. Accuracy: data loggers are accurate

2. Management Tool: Because it performs many other

functions product result in handy form.

3. Ease in use: It communicate with operators in a normal

human logical manner.
